Senator Flanagan Wins 14-9

November 16, 2018

ALBANY, NY – On the Twitter Page of New York 1’s Zack Fink, it says that State Senator John Flanagan, who was Senate Majority Leader when the GOP held the majority in the state senate, Flanagan has been elected as Senate Minority Leader. The vote was 14-9.

On David Lombardo’s Twitter Page (he’s an Albany Times Union reporter) it lists the nine senators who supported Senator Cathy Young:‏

George Amedore (Montgomery County), Jim Tedisco (Schenectady County), Joe Robach (Monroe), Robert Ortt (Niagara County), Rich Funke (Monroe), Tom O’Mara (Chemung, Steuben Co’s), Pamela Helming (Ontario, Wayne Co’s), Sue Serino (Dutchess County) and Cathy Young (Allegany, Chautauqua, Cattaraugus Co’s).
